在Ubuntu上實現Jellyfin多用戶管理,可以按照以下步驟進行:
首先,確保你的Ubuntu系統已經更新到最新版本:
sudo apt update
sudo apt upgrade -y
然后,安裝Jellyfin服務器:
sudo apt install jellyfin -y
或者,你可以使用Snap包來安裝Jellyfin:
sudo apt install snapd -y
sudo snap refresh
sudo snap find jellyfin
sudo snap install jellyfin --classic
安裝完成后,啟動Jellyfin服務并設置為開機自啟:
sudo systemctl start jellyfin
sudo systemctl enable jellyfin
在首次訪問Jellyfin的Web界面時,你需要創建一個管理員賬戶。提供所需的信息(如用戶名和密碼),然后繼續登錄。
登錄到Jellyfin服務器后,你可以通過選擇“添加媒體庫”來添加媒體。選擇適當的媒體類型(如電影、電視節目或音樂)并按照提示添加媒體文件夾。
在Jellyfin的Web界面中,你可以為每個用戶創建單獨的賬戶,并為每個賬戶分配不同的權限。這包括對媒體庫的訪問權限、播放權限等。你可以設置用戶賬戶的個性化設置,例如設置用戶喜歡的主題或推薦列表。
在Jellyfin的配置界面中,你可以設置哪些用戶可以訪問哪些媒體庫,以及他們可以執行哪些操作,比如播放、下載或上傳媒體文件。
為了允許外部訪問Jellyfin服務器,你需要在Jellyfin的Web界面中配置網絡設置。你可以設置靜態IP地址或動態DNS(DDNS),并配置防火墻規則以允許通過Jellyfin服務器的端口(默認是8096)的流量。
為了提高安全性,你可以配置SSL證書。你可以使用Let’s Encrypt免費獲取SSL證書,并使用Certbot來自動完成這個過程。
sudo apt install certbot python3-certbot-apache -y
sudo certbot --apache -d your_domain
使用Nginx或Apache作為反向代理,以提供更安全的訪問和更好的性能。
/etc/jellyfin/config
,你可以根據需要修改配置文件中的設置。以上步驟應該能幫助你在Ubuntu上成功配置Jellyfin多用戶管理。如果在配置過程中遇到任何問題,可以參考Jellyfin的官方文檔或社區論壇尋求幫助。